Market Overview: Rising Adoption of Predictive Intelligence in Engine Systems

Predictive engine control software is designed to analyze real-time and historical performance data to forecast engine behavior and optimize operating parameters. This allows systems to anticipate load changes, environmental variations, and mechanical stress—resulting in improved efficiency and durability.

According to Research Intelo’s ongoing assessments, demand is expected to rise steadily over the coming years as global regulatory bodies intensify emission norms and fuel efficiency standards. Predictive intelligence allows manufacturers to comply with these regulations while minimizing operational costs.

The integration of predictive software also aligns with the automotive sector's broader shift toward connected and autonomous mobility. As vehicles become more software-dependent, predictive engine controls play a central role in delivering smoother power management and reduced failure risks.


Key Market Drivers Propelling Growth

1. Tightening Emission Regulations:
Governments worldwide are enforcing strict emission policies, pushing OEMs to incorporate smarter engine management technologies. Predictive software helps vehicles achieve compliance through real-time optimization.

2. Growing Demand for AI-Integrated Mobility:
The shift toward intelligent mobility and connected powertrains is boosting the adoption of engine analytics solutions.

3. Need for Improved Fuel Efficiency:
Predictive control reduces unnecessary fuel consumption by optimizing combustion and adjusting engine parameters based on driving patterns.

4. Expansion of Fleet Management Solutions:
Organizations managing large fleets increasingly rely on predictive analytics to reduce downtime and maintenance costs.

5. Advanced Onboard Diagnostics (OBD) Adoption:
Modern diagnostic platforms are more accurate when supported by predictive algorithms that detect engine abnormalities early.


Key Restraints Slowing Market Growth

While growth prospects remain strong, several challenges are influencing market development:

  • High integration costs for advanced predictive technologies

  • Limited awareness in emerging markets

  • Complex algorithm deployment, particularly for legacy engine systems

  • Data privacy and cyber-risk concerns associated with connected engines

These factors may temporarily hinder adoption but are expected to diminish as technology costs fall and global digital infrastructure improves.
